Canonical is the company behind Ubuntu, the world's most popular open-source operating system, which provides fast, modern, and secure Linux solutions for desktops, servers, and cloud environments. They offer a comprehensive set of products and services, including Ubuntu Desktop, Ubuntu Server, cloud solutions such as OpenStack, and tools for managing containerized applications with Kubernetes. Canonical focuses on making open-source technology reliable and accessible across various industries, from IoT and AI to enterprise infrastructure.

📋 Description

• Leading their teams in elevating the Linux developer and user experience • Designing, building and shipping high quality, performant software in Rust, Go and Python • Demonstrating sound engineering principles through architecture, development and code reviews • Taking responsibility for planning, estimation and execution • Working with product management to define the vision and strategy for Ubuntu • Setting expectations with other engineering teams, senior management, and external stakeholders • Offering coaching, mentoring, technical feedback and hands-on career development • Contributing to upstream and neighboring open source projects • Optimizing the distribution for performance, reliability, and security • Debugging complex system-level issues and delivering robust solutions • Authoring and improving technical and community documentation

🎯 Requirements

• An exceptional academic track record from both high school and university • Undergraduate degree in Computer Science or STEM, or a compelling narrative about your alternative path • Ability to drive and deliver technical work streams going above and beyond expectations • Lead and coach others to deliver exceptional engineering work • A demonstrated passion for open source software • Significant experience with Rust, Go, Python, Flutter or C/C++ • Professional written and spoken English • Excellent communication and interpersonal skills • Result-oriented, with a personal drive to meet commitments • Ability to travel twice a year, for company events up to two weeks each

🏖️ Benefits

• Distributed work environment with twice-yearly team sprints in person • Personal learning and development budget of USD 2,000 per year • Annual compensation review • Recognition rewards • Annual holiday leave • Maternity and paternity leave • Employee Assistance Programme • Opportunity to travel to new locations to meet colleagues • Priority Pass, and travel upgrades for long haul company events
